Effective Immediately:

 

If your vehicle was towed for the following reasons you may obtain a release directly from Rick’s Towing (317) 823-3475.

 

  1. Vehicles abandoned/disabled in the roadway.
  2. Vehicles owned by crime victims such as Recovered Stolen Vehicles (once the vehicle has been processed for prints if necessary) or vehicles impounded that have been abandoned and vandalized where the impound is to protect the owner from further damage.
  3. Vehicles involved in accidents.
  4. Vehicles required to be removed from the street to allow snow plow access.
  5. Vehicles towed for Indiana Statute Non-owner in possession. (This is used where the circumstances are suspicious i.e. a driver unable to give the owners name etc.)

 

Vehicles that require a release from the Lawrence Police Department are as follows:

 

  1. Driver arrested.
  2. Driver issued a traffic violation ticket.
  3. Driver is issued a Summons in lieu of outright arrest.
  4. Suspect vehicles in hit/run accidents.
  5. Vehicles otherwise involved in criminal situations.

 

Vehicle releases, gun permits & case reports are available at the LPD records office.

Vehicle Releases:

In order to obtain a release you will need to present identification showing that you are the titled and registered owner of the vehicle. Registrations must be current. If you are not the titled owner, you must have a notarized statement from the titled owner giving you permission to obtain a release on their behalf. If you possess the vehicle title you must register the vehicle in your name prior to obtaining the release. Vehicles with title only may be released to the confirmed owner as long as the vehicle will be towed from the impound lot by the owner. Unregistered vehicles are not allowed to be on the street. A release fee of $10.00 must be paid at the Records Desk which is located at 9001 E. 59th Street Lawrence, IN 46216 317-549-6404. Payment to LPD for the vehicle release may be made by cash, cashier’s check from a bank or money order. A map to the wrecker lot may be obtained from the Record’s Desk. Releases may be obtained Monday through Friday 8 a.m. to 4:30 p.m. See the web page for additional holiday closures.  If you have questions regarding the release procedure you may call the Records Desk at 317-549-6404 during business hours.

If your vehicle was impounded by an agency other than the Lawrence Police Department, you will need to contact that agency for release information.

Police Reports:

Police report copies may be obtained during normal business hours by paying a fee of $5.00 per report type, i.e. Accident reports, CAD history reports, police reports. Accident reports may also be obtained on-line at BuyCrash.com (follow the information on the web page for purchase).

Fingerprint cards may be completed for those in need for a fee of $10.00.

Gun Permits:

·         All gun permits are issued using the criteria set forth by the Indiana State Police Firearms Application Procedures.

·         Handwritten packets are available in the Records Office at LPD if you do not have internet access.

·         On line applications may be found on the Indiana State Police web page found at  WWW.ISP.IN.GOV under Firearms Licensing.

·         Click on the application for hand gun license

·         Select Marion County

·         Complete the Application and hit submit.

·         Print out the confirmation notice

·         Bring the confirmation notice to the Lawrence Police Department to finalize processing.

·         Instructions for the electronic fingerprinting procedures are available on the ISP web page found at WWW.ISP.IN.GOV.
